Functional Resume Template

The functional resume template focuses on your skills rather than your work history. This format is ideal for college students with limited work experience or those changing careers.

Skills Section

In the skills section, list your key abilities, both hard and soft. Be specific about how you've developed these skills, such as through coursework, projects, or internships.

For example, if you list 'Problem-solving' as a skill, you might elaborate on it by mentioning a specific project where you had to overcome a significant challenge.

Qualifications Section

The qualifications section provides more context for your skills. Here, you can describe how you've applied your skills in real-world situations, such as through internships, part-time jobs, or academic projects.

For instance, if you've listed 'Project Management' as a skill, you might explain in the qualifications section how you led a team of five students to complete a semester-long project on time and within budget.

Chronological Resume Template

The chronological resume template focuses on your work history, listing your experiences in reverse-chronological order. This format is suitable for college students with relevant work experience, such as internships or part-time jobs.

Work Experience Section

In the work experience section, list your relevant jobs and internships. For each role, briefly describe your responsibilities and the skills you demonstrated. Use action verbs to start each bullet point, and quantify your achievements where possible.

For example, instead of saying 'Helped with social media management,' you might say 'Managed social media accounts, increasing engagement by 30% over three months.'

Education Section

As a college student, your education section is crucial. List your degree(s) in reverse-chronological order, including the institution name, location, and expected graduation date (or graduation date if you've already completed your degree).

You can also include your GPA if it's above a 3.0, as well as any relevant coursework or academic achievements.
